Iron is extracted from its ore, haematite in a blast furnace. The ore is led into the top of the furnace along with coke and limestone. The limestone decomposes in the hot furnace, forming calcium oxide. This reacts with the sandy impurities (silicon dioxide) to form a slag.

The method used to extract copper from its ores depends on the nature of the ore. Sulfide ores such as chalcopyrite (CuFeS2) are converted to copper by a different method from silicate, carbonate or sulfate ores. Chalcopyrite (also known as copper pyrites) and similar sulfide ores are the commonest ores of copper.

This reaction has the following chemical equation: Fe2O3 + 3CO 2Fe + 3CO2. The molten iron settles to the bottom of the furnace where it is tapped off. The last reaction that happens in the furnace is the forming of slag. Calcium oxide and the impurities from the iron ore react to from this slag.

The ore obtained from mines are broken down into small piece by jaw crusher and then pulverized. The ore being sulphide ore is concentrated by froth floatation process. Pulverized ore is kept in water containing pine oil and the mixture is agitated by passing compressed air.

The process which gives the ore such a physical form so that the gauge can be easily removed from it is called dressing of the ore. It is done by hand-picking, grinding, etc. Bauxite ore generally contains ferric oxide and silica as impurities. Dressing of Bauxite ore is done by crushing and pulverising.

The overall process Titanium is extracted from its ore, rutile - TiO 2. It is first converted into titanium (IV) chloride, which is then reduced to titanium using either magnesium or sodium. Conversion of TiO2 into TiCl4 The ore rutile (impure titanium (IV) oxide) is heated with chlorine and coke at a temperature of about 1000°C.

Sep 27, 2021Calcination: the concentrated ore is then calcined in a furnace. During this process moisture is removed, impurities such as sulfur, phosphorus, and arsenic are converted to their gaseous oxides which then ultimately escape, ferrous carbonate if present changes to oxide. S + O2 → SO2 4As + O2 → 2As2O3 P4 + 5O2 → P4O10 FeCO3 → FeO + CO2

This extraction of crude metal from the ore is done for extracting copper from copper sulphides, lead from lead sulphides and zinc from zinc sulphides. After this step, the oxide of the metals is then reduced by heating them in the presence of carbon. Carbon reduces the oxides to pure metals as it takes away oxygen to form carbon oxides.

Oct 5, 2021The following steps can be used to extract the metal (Hg) from the ore. Step 1: In the air, roast concentrated mercury (II) sulphide ore. Roasting is the process of turning a sulphide ore into its equivalent metal oxides by rapidly heating it in the presence of air.

Apr 20, 2022Calcination is the process of turning ore into an oxide by exposing it to high temperatures. Ore is heated below its melting point in the absence of air or with a regulated supply of air. This procedure converts carbonates and hydroxides into their corresponding oxides.

Since most ores being processed today contain from about 0.02% to 0.2% recoverable uranium, it is necessary to process from 500 to 5000 kg ore for each kilogram of uranium recovered. To produce the same amount of uranium, therefore, mill- size can vary by a factor of 10.

Copper can be extracted from non-sulphide ores by a different process involving three separate stages: Reaction of the ore (over quite a long time and on a huge scale) with a dilute acid such as dilute sulphuric acid to produce a very dilute copper (II) sulphate solution. Concentration of the copper (II) sulphate solution by solvent extraction.

Any calcium in the concentrated brine is removed as calcium carbonate by adding sodium carbonate. The brine that results from these chemical precipitations is then subjected to a carbonation process, where the lithium reacts with sodium carbonate at 80-90°C to produce technical-grade lithium carbonate.

An ore is usually a compound of the metal mixed with impurities. When the metal is dug up, a method must be used to separate the metal from the rest of the ore. This is called extracting the metal. The method of extraction depends on how reactive the metal is. The more reactive the metal, the more difficult it is to extract from its compound.
